Curvature Flow of Networks with Triple Junction Drag and Grain Rotation

Published 7 Sep 2025 in math.AP | (2509.06125v1)

Abstract: We prove a local existence result for a PDE system that describes curvature motion of networks with a dynamic boundary condition known as triple junction drag. This model arises in the study of grain boundary evolution in polycrystalline materials. We demonstrate the possibility of a new type of topological change during the evolution of the network. Moreover, we adopt a dynamic surface tension model that depends on the crystallographic orientations of the grains, which are allowed to rotate. Lastly, we study how the stability of stationary solutions depend on the choice of surface tension.
